Syntech Recruitment are supporting a leading precision engineering and manufacturing organisation in the search for an experienced Quality Engineer. This role would suit a quality professional with a strong manufacturing background who is experienced in customer and supplier quality management, quality systems, auditing and continuous improvement.

Quality Engineer Responsibilities

  • Act as the primary quality interface between customers, suppliers and manufacturing teams
  • Investigate and resolve quality-related issues across production operations
  • Train manufacturing personnel on inspection methods, quality standards and measurement techniques
  • Manage and maintain calibration systems for measurement and test equipment
  • Support the setup and control of inspection equipment used within production
  • Develop and implement quality improvement initiatives
  • Translate customer quality requirements into manufacturing documentation and processes
  • Produce inspection reports, trend analysis and quality performance metrics
  • Manage non-conformances and customer complaints using structured problem-solving methodologies including 8D and 5 Why analysis

Quality Engineer Requirements

  • Minimum five years' experience within a Quality Engineer or similar manufacturing quality role
  • Mechanical engineering apprenticeship or equivalent engineering background
  • Strong understanding of manufacturing quality systems and processes
  • Ability to interpret complex engineering drawings
  • Experience using a range of inspection and measurement techniques
  • Proven experience producing inspection reports and quality documentation
  • Strong customer and supplier quality management experience
  • Experience conducting internal and supplier audits
  • Project management and stakeholder coordination skills
  • Competent user of Microsoft Office applications
  • Ability to train and mentor colleagues on quality-related subjects
